I did a driving experience in a Radical SR3 on Monday during which the sessions were recorded on their in car action camera, which has a cool setup with overlays for gear, speed, GeForce and track position. I thought it was a GoPro but the file type is a MOV (720p) and the files start SCHD0XXX. Unfortunately the footage of myself driving is corrupt. The card still has the hotlap so I have an example file.

I have tried all sorts to recover it, a couple of recovery tools including the Grau Video Recovery tool. I also tried recover_mp4 with ffmpeg which is the closest I go with a green garble when you can make out outlines and some of the overlay. Sound is ok. I also tried uploading to YouTube, loading into light room, the VLC covert trick. I am out of ideas.

Long shot, but does anyone have any other suggestions please? It really sucks I lost the footage :(
